The Shift to Smart Manufacturing in Bread

The bakery industry is embracing digital transformation. Smart manufacturing allows for automation, real-time monitoring, and data connectivity across the bread production line. This ensures every stage—from mixing to packaging—operates with precision, traceability, and minimal waste.

Labor & Cost Pressures Driving Automation

Rising labor costs and shortages continue to push bakeries toward automation. Automated bread production lines can reduce manual dependence by up to 60%, delivering higher output and consistent quality while cutting production costs significantly.

Consumer Demand for Functional Bread

Consumers are shifting toward bread that does more—low-carb, protein-rich, gluten-free, or fortified with vitamins. These market shifts demand flexible bread production lines capable of adapting recipes and handling diverse dough textures efficiently.

AI-Driven Efficiency in Bread Production

Artificial intelligence is revolutionizing the bread production line. AI-enabled systems monitor performance, adjust variables automatically, and help bakeries make data-driven decisions.

Using Predictive Analytics for Downtime

Predictive analytics identify potential machine failures before they occur. This reduces unplanned downtime and maintenance costs, keeping bread production lines running at optimal efficiency.

Optimizing Recipes via Machine Learning

Machine learning analyzes ingredient data and environmental factors to refine recipes. Whether adjusting fermentation time or oven temperature, smart algorithms ensure ideal texture and flavor for every loaf.

Bread Production Line Real-Time Monitoring

Sensors along the bread production line track temperature, humidity, speed, and weight. Real-time dashboards alert operators to any deviation, ensuring consistency and reducing product waste.

Robotics and Advanced Handling Systems

bread production line

Collaborative Robots (Cobots) for Packing

Cobots now work safely alongside human operators to pack and arrange bread efficiently. Their adaptability makes them ideal for bakeries with mixed product lines or frequent format changes.

High-Speed Sorting on the Production Line

Automated sorting systems enhance throughput and accuracy. These systems can handle hundreds of loaves per minute while maintaining hygiene and reducing human contact.

Precision Shaping and Decoration

Advanced robotic arms allow precise shaping, scoring, and decoration of bread products—from baguettes to artisan rolls—delivering artisanal aesthetics at an industrial scale.

Application: Flexibility & Product Innovation

Modular Design for Flexible Bread Lines

A modular bread production line offers scalability and adaptability. Whether increasing capacity or adding new product types, modules can be replaced or expanded without complete system overhauls.

Quick Changeovers for Small Batch Runs

Flexibility is key in modern bakeries. Quick-change systems allow operators to switch between products in under 30 minutes, reducing downtime and supporting small-batch production trends.

Customizing Equipment for Flatbreads

Flatbreads, pita, and wraps require specific temperature and humidity profiles. Custom modules on the bread production line can optimize baking zones for these specialized products.

The Role of Bread Production Flexibility

Flexible bread production lines empower bakeries to innovate faster—launching seasonal items, testing new formulations, or meeting unique dietary trends with ease.

Gluten-Free and Plant-Based Dough Handling

Specialized dough requires isolated mixing and shaping systems to prevent cross-contamination. Dedicated bread production line modules ensure food safety while maintaining texture and flavor integrity.

Integrating Fortified & Functional Ingredients

Modern dosing systems handle precise measurements of fibers, proteins, and supplements. This ensures consistent distribution and regulatory compliance in fortified bread products.

Equipment for Sourdough Bread Production

Sourdough remains a global favorite. Specialized fermentation chambers and humidity-controlled proofers replicate traditional processes while ensuring industrial-scale consistency.

Sustainability and Hygiene Standards

Sustainable Practices in Bread Production

Sustainability has become non-negotiable. Bakeries are implementing eco-friendly designs that minimize waste, optimize energy use, and support carbon reduction goals.

Minimizing Waste with Precise Dosing

Accurate ingredient dosing reduces material waste and maintains recipe consistency, ensuring both environmental and economic benefits.

Next-Gen Energy-Efficient Ovens

New-generation tunnel ovens consume 20–30% less energy by using heat recovery systems and advanced insulation, making them a cornerstone of sustainable bread production lines.

Lowering the Carbon Footprint of the Line

Energy monitoring systems help track and reduce CO₂ emissions per batch, aligning bakery operations with global environmental standards.

Hygienic Design and Food Safety

CIP (Clean-In-Place) Ready Equipment

CIP systems allow automated cleaning without disassembly, saving time and ensuring consistent sanitation across the bread production line.

Ensuring Full Traceability of Every Loaf

Digital traceability systems record ingredient origins, processing parameters, and quality checks—critical for compliance and consumer confidence.

Designing the Bread Line for Inspection

Transparent covers, tool-free assembly, and easy access for inspection simplify cleaning and maintenance while supporting stringent hygiene protocols.
